A biotechnology company is seeking a Project Manager to support project planning and execution. Responsibilities include monitoring progress, coordinating teams, and communicating updates.
The ideal candidate will have 5-6 years of project management experience in relevant fields, strong organizational skills, and proficiency in project management tools.
The role offers a salary range of £29.00 - £36.00 per hour based on skills and experience.
